About one year ago, I stayed in the house of an old lady for more than half a year as a tenant. Since the old lady was a Falun Gong practitioner, I had an opportunity to understand closely the lives of Falun Gong practitioners and their thoughts. Although I have moved out, I still keep in contact with them. During that period of time, I was really impressed by the perseverance and compassion of the old landlord.

Via the introduction of a friend two years ago, I happily moved into the house of the old lady with a rent lower than the market price. She lived alone because her husband had passed away years ago, and her sons and daughters all lived elsewhere. The old lady told me that the reason why she let me move in was because she knew from a Falun Gong practitioner that I was sympathetic towards Falun Gong, and since there were always Falun Gong practitioners coming and going from her house, and she was worried that it might cause inconvenience to the tenant.

It was a spacious house with a big living room inside. When it came to weekends, some 10 or 20 practitioners of various ages and sexes would come to the house, and sit on the floor of the living room, and took turns to read Zhuan Falun for two hours. Then, they would hold a discussion session, during which they talked about their own experiences and family issues. Whenever someone was confused over some issue, the participants would help to resolve it based on their understanding of the “Fa-principles”. The participants could be doctors and post-doctors from prestigious universities, businessmen, chefs, or baby-sitters, but they were all equal in the living room. I was very curious about them so that I often joined their conversations, and talked to them about my viewpoints as an ordinary person. They treated me as a person with pre-destined relationship, and tried quite hard to explain to me. Although they have never persuaded me, I did not persuade them, either. In the end, we respected the each other’s choices, and stopped attempting to convince each other.

They were just like a big family. They helped and encouraged each other. Although conflicts were inevitable, and even profound at times, they always “searched inside”, so the conflicts never hindered their feeling as a group. The old lady was not home quite often because she attended activities to promote Falun Gong in other areas. Whenever there were public activities, such as setting up information boards, distributing flyers, or exercise demonstrations, the local Falun Gong practitioners would try their best to participate. However, in many small towns where only one or two Falun Gong practitioners were present, and the workload exceeded the capacity of the local practitioners, the old lady would rush to help because her time was more flexible. Many Falun Gong practitioners had the key of the old lady’s house so that the Fa-study during the weekends still took place even when she was not out of town.

The basement of the house was very large. There were several old computers installed to enable e-mail exchanges with China and to log onto Internet chat rooms. Although the old lady came from Taiwan, where a different spelling system was used, she learned how to key in simple Chinese greeting sentences in a computer. She also learned how to access the Internet, how to send e-mail messages, and how to log onto chat rooms. She could not type too many Chinese characters. Fortunately, the Falun Gong practitioners who were good at computer technology developed a program that can paste information about the truth of Falun Gong automatically. She learned how to paste the prepared information onto the chat rooms.

I did not quite agree with this way of pasting information about the truth of the persecution. On one occasion when the old lady was busy pasting the truth-material to the chat rooms, I joked to her, “Who are you harassing?” The old lady was stupefied and stayed silent for a while. She turned her head and looked at me. On her face was a sorrowful look. Her lips moved a little, but no words came out of the mouth. Then, she turned her head back to the computer. I did not care about it too much at that time, and started reading the news on the computer. After a period of silence, the old lady got up and went upstairs.

Later on, the old lady told me what I said on that day deeply hurt her heart— she actually went upstairs and cried. She was sincerely “rescuing people”, but I misinterpreted it as harassing people. She said it was Falun Gong practitioners’ fault if the future of the Chinese people were negatively influenced because they were deceived and did not understand the actual situation of Falun Gong. On the contrary, if the Chinese people were aware of the truth, and still hostile to Falun Gong, it would their own choice. What Falun Gong practitioners should do was to make more people realise the truth so that they would have opportunities to eradicate their hostility against Falun Gong. The purpose was to save them.

Although I don’t quite agree in doing so because there are many people who did not want to receive the truth materials, I am sure Falun Gong practitioners’ thought is sincere and compassionate. The old lady was in a deep sorrow because I could not understand her.

In a certain period of time, Falun Gong took the initiative of doing an SOS walk appeal. The old lady discussed with the other three elderly Falun Gong practitioners about walking across the state where I reside. Although this state is one of the smallest states, it would take several weeks to travel across on foot. I tried to persuade her to drop the idea because of her age. However, the old lady had made up her mind. They set off several days later. There was a car following behind them to carry food, water and sleeping blankets. They wore yellow Falun Gong T-shirts with a board “Stop Persecuting Falun Gong” hung on their backs. Whenever they arrived in a city or a town along the road, they would go to the city counsel to meet councilors, and introduce the situation of the persecution of Falun Gong in China. They would also conduct other activities such as distributing flyers on the streets. They spent more than 2 weeks on the road. By the time they got back, their faces were dark because of sunburn.

Falun Gong practitioners hold Fa-conferences (also called experience-sharing conference) several times in different major cities of USA, including New York, Washington DC, and Chicago. Other European cities such as Geneva also host Fa-conferences sometimes. The old lady attended almost every Fa-conference. She would share a car ride with other practitioners if the location was within driving range. If it was too far, she would take an airplane. The travel expense was in the range of one hundred to six hundred dollars. The old lady was not reluctant in making this expenditure, but the food and clothing in her ordinary life was very simple. On one occasion, a friend accompanied her to buy new clothes. The friend strongly recommended her to buy more expensive clothes for higher quality. The old lady could not resist her friend’s recommendation and bought it home. She thought about it over and over again once she got back home. In the end, she returned the high-quality clothes to the store, and exchanged them for very cheap ones. At that time, she had just sold a house, and was not short of money. However, she said that the money obtained from selling the houses could provide freedom for her to spread the truth about the persecution, and should not be spent on clothes.

It is a very common phenomenon for Falun Gong practitioners to bear hardships. They can spend money to make banners, rent a place for conference, make flyers, or make advertisements on newspaper, but they are very frugal in eating and clothing. In a very extreme case, a doctor, who came from Texas to attend the Fa-conference in the city where I reside, stayed in the old lady’s house. He ate only streamed buns and pickled vegetables for almost every meal.

Some people said those Falun Gong practitioners who attended Fa-conferences or protest activities were hired with money. This did not conform to what I saw. Once, I drove with several Falun Gong practitioners to Washington D. C. — they attended the Fa-conference, while I visited museums.
